Ninox features and specs

  • Versatility
    Ninox offers a robust set of features that cater to various business needs, including database management, workflow automation, and integration capabilities, making it suitable for many different types of users and industries.
  • User-Friendly Interface
    Ninox has an intuitive and user-friendly interface, which makes it relatively easy for users to create and manage databases without requiring deep technical knowledge.
  • Cloud and On-Premises Options
    Ninox offers both cloud-based and on-premises solutions, giving organizations the flexibility to choose the deployment method that best suits their security and access needs.
  • Cross-Platform Support
    Ninox is available on various platforms including iOS, macOS, and Windows, in addition to a web-based version. This makes it accessible from almost any device.
  • Customization
    Users can customize tables, forms, fields, and reports to tailor the application to their specific needs, enhancing its flexibility and usability.

Possible disadvantages of Ninox

  • Pricing
    Compared to some other database management and automation tools, Ninox can be relatively expensive, especially for smaller organizations with limited budgets.
  • Learning Curve
    While Ninox is user-friendly, there is still a learning curve associated with mastering its full suite of features, especially for users who are not familiar with database management concepts.
  • Limited Public API
    Ninox has a limited public API, which can restrict its integration capabilities with some third-party applications and services, posing a challenge for users with complex integration needs.
  • Complexity with Advanced Features
    The more advanced features of Ninox, such as scripting for automation and complex database relationships, may require more technical knowledge and could be daunting for less experienced users.
  • Mobile App Limitations
    Although the mobile app is functional, it can sometimes lack the full feature set of the desktop and web versions, leading to a less optimal experience on mobile devices.

SQL Azure features and specs

  • Scalability
    SQL Azure provides scalable performance that can be adjusted based on demand without downtime, allowing businesses to handle varying workloads efficiently.
  • Managed Service
    As a fully managed service, SQL Azure reduces administrative overhead by handling updates, backups, and maintenance automatically, freeing up IT resources for other tasks.
  • High Availability
    Built-in high availability and disaster recovery features ensure continuous data access and reliability, minimizing downtime and protecting data integrity.
  • Security
    SQL Azure offers advanced security features, including network isolation, encryption, and threat detection, enhancing data protection and compliance with security standards.
  • Integration with Microsoft Ecosystem
    Seamless integration with other Microsoft services and tools such as Power BI, Azure Data Factory, and Azure Synapse enhances capabilities for data analysis and management.

Possible disadvantages of SQL Azure

  • Cost
    The pay-as-you-go pricing model can become expensive for businesses with large-scale demands or unpredictable usage patterns, potentially increasing operational costs.
  • Limited Control
    Because it is a managed service, users have less control over server configurations and customizations, which can be a limitation for certain specialized requirements.
  • Dependency on Internet Connectivity
    As a cloud-based service, consistent internet connectivity is required to access SQL Azure, which can be a disadvantage for locations with unreliable internet service.
  • Learning Curve
    Organizations may need to invest time and resources into training staff to understand and optimize Azure SQL features, which can delay implementation.
  • Data Transfer Costs
    There may be additional costs associated with transferring data in and out of SQL Azure, particularly for businesses that frequently move large volumes of data.
